Advances in ultrasound technology are reshaping the field of health care for obstetricians and pediatric specialists. Detailed fetal imaging has enabled medical professionals to detect fetal structural anomalies and research practical guidelines for prenatal diagnosis and postnatal management. Fetal Anomalies: Ultrasound Diagnosis and Postnatal Management is a practical sourcebook with images of structural fetal malformations on a continuum that begins at the stage of ultrasonographic identification, progressing to characterization in the newborn period, and culminating in repair and postoperative follow up.<p></p><ul><li>Externally visible defects </li><li>Skeletal dysplasia </li><li>Central nervous, gastrointestinal, urinary, and genital systems </li><li>Umbilical cord anomalies </li><li>Abnormalities specific to multiple pregnancies </li><li>Abnormalities of amniotic fluid volume </li><li>Abnormalities that elude prenatal detection</li></ul>
